Subject: Ownership change — calendar sync conflict resolver

As of this sprint, responsibility for the SyncWeave conflict-resolution module is moving off my plate. The open review covering the double-booking detection logic still stands; please continue your review as planned, but route follow-up comments and approval requests to the new owner rather than me. Context on the three-way merge edge cases is in the design doc. The module now belongs to:

named custodian: Brivan Eliath Quenox Frador

### Runbook: Regenerating the lint baseline

If Scanhawk starts flagging hundreds of pre-existing issues, the baseline file is probably stale. Don't panic — just rerun `scanhawk baseline --refresh` from the repo root and commit the result. The refresh hits our internal analysis service, so you'll need auth set up first. Export the key below before running the command.

gateway credential: kto23_LX9A4ys6i4nzHtpOLNLodKK

Subject: Dedup release handover

Norle,

Handing off MergeRight 1.9. The customer-record dedup pass now uses fuzzy surname matching; false-merge rate is under 0.2% on the Haldern dataset. Review the match-threshold diff before tagging. Rollback plan is in the runbook. Artifacts are built on the Crestin pipeline and must be signed prior to publish. Use the release key below.

signing key of bagap-yawep = bky13_TbfT6ZMUoGJo2

Handover note — Crumbwheel order cutoffs.

Welcome aboard. The bakery cutoff rule in Crumbwheel closes same-day orders at 14:00 local to each storefront, not UTC — this has bitten us twice. Holiday overrides live in the calendar service and take precedence silently, so always check there first when a cutoff looks wrong. To unlock the calendar service's admin console after a restart, enter the recovery passphrase below.

vault phrase of bagap-bahaf = silion-pelox-sorox-casdor-quenwyn-fraax-eliox-praael-kelion-quenvan-kasox-rusael-norius-belvan